I’m really unsure why more people don’t use JScan, especially when using the Tazer. The changes are permanent, much easier to program, less money and you don’t have to remove it for warranty work. Plus, as I said, you don’t need to leave it hooked up to keep your changes working. Do it once and forget about it.
I encourage more people to download JScan from the Apple or Google store and try it. It has a demo mode that allows you to make any changes you want without actually hooking it up so you can see how easy it is and learn the programming. Then when you’re ready you buy the license for $20. All in for about $65 with the cable and dongle you need. Does not effect warranty and if the Dealer goes into the computer there is no sign of anyone messing around.
you can also change the Speedo for gears and tires, turn on/off OEM options if you want to add or remove. If you want to add LED head, turn or fog lights you can turn those features on and not have to use resistors. If you add a hardtop you can turn on the wiper and defroster. Basically anything that’s programmable can be done. Including turning off the ESS.

I have both but it would be nice for the owners that simply didn’t want start stop to not have to pay for a solution.
I agree, but the reality is it’s part of the law and is illegal to turn them off if so equipped, so no one can make them optional if installed, legally. The easiest and cheapest way is just a $25 eliminator which turns on no lights and has no negative effects. JScan is great because many people with jeeps like to fiddle with stuff and this allows you to do it easily and not have to leave something plugged in that must be removed before going in for warranty work.
I’m sure tons of people leave them in and have no issues, but all it takes is one time and you will always have problems after that.
